During early years of the 21st century a small group of well known chowists decided to form the North Florida Chow Chow Club. Although the membership was small, they had a history of being active Chow fanciers.

 

Our first year of activity consisted primarily of trying to get new members and drum up enthusiasm for our club. We started with a chairperson and a recording secretary to organize our meetings. A decision was made to keep it this way until membership had increased to the point where we could have elections.

 

Before you knew it, we were able to start having fun matches. These seemed to go over very well and created the kind of excitement our club was looking for. People who had not been a part of the club, showed up for the matches and from there joined the club.

 

By the time our first year ended we had enough members to have elections. We were able to fill the positions of president, vice president, secretary, treasurer and three board members.

 

We immediately forged a constitution and sent it to the AKC for approval along with official recognition of the clubs name. Within a couple of months our club name (North Florida Chow Chow Club) was accepted and we were an official AKC club.
